Transaction 98614728aae2eb94befd230529413e1d69a1f38bfd7331263e5836d35b14f0da
1 Input
1 Output
-
98614728aae2eb94befd230529413e1d69a1f38bfd7331263e5836d35b14f0da:0
- value
- 8623379
- script pubkey
- OP_0 OP_PUSHBYTES_20 221cd2dbabfa60ebb3e0950f2cb0142b4f00bd32
- address
- bc1qygwd9katlfswhvlqj58jevq59d8sp0fjpr06ce